The host Cassopolis Lady Rangers came into the 2005 season having not won a single Lakeland Conference game since 2002.
On Wednesday Cassopolis swept visiting Berrien Springs to win their third and fourth league games of the season.
Cassopolis took the first game 10-0 and then won the nightcap, 7-2.
The Lady Rangers may only be 7-15 on the year and 4-12 in the league, but Cassopolis has come a long way in a short period of time under new head coach Randy Brooks.
The phases of the game where the Lady Rangers have improved the most have been in defense and pitching.
Both were solid on Tuesday, May 17 when Cassopolis lost to Lakeland Conference champion Brandywine, 3-1 and 4-0.
But Wednesday the Lady Rangers got to shine on offense against the Lady Shamrocks.
Freshman Symone Pompey tossed a no-hitter with nine strike outs and just one walk in the opening game for Cassopolis.
Randi Hoffman was the winning pitcher in the second game.
Ashley Solloway and Becky File both singled and doubled in the opener, while in the nightcap, Jealyn Foston had two singles.
Lawton Invitational
The Cassopolis varsity softball team won two out of three games on Saturday at the Lawton Invitational.
The Lady Rangers (9-16) have now won four out of their last five games.
At Lawton, Cassopolis lost the opening game 11-0 to Hartford, but bounced back to defeat Lawrence 8-6 and Decatur, 15-1.
Randi Hoffman took the loss in the first game, but was the winner against Decatur. Symone Pompey was the winning pitcher against Lawrence.
Cass had just five hits against Hartford, but banged out 12 hits against Lawrence.
Baily Wyant had a double and three singles, while Jessica Frucci singled and doubled. Nikitas Nelson added three singles. Kayla Green had two hits.
The Lady Rangers had 14 hits against Decatur.
Jealyn Foston led the way with a double and a triple. Frucci added a single and a double, while Hoffman also doubled. Cassopolis also got two hits from Wyant, Ashley McCoy and Molly Vite.
